Background

The importance of KOPPARA NarasimhaDevaru  situated in Karnataka (India), Raichur Dist. Devadurga Taluka are described in Mantralaya(53).

Long back there was a Rishi-sadhu by name Kaarpara Rishi. On the wide and sacred bank of Krishna river,he decided to propitiate Sri Hari.As the Rishi completely satisfied with the calm and quiet panorama of that surrounding place. Kaarpara Rishi will take a holy dip
in the  Krishna and sat under the shelter of an Ashwath Vraksha praying to Sri Hari-Vishnu-Narayana-the Omniscient and Omnipotent who
is protecting the world.This holy routine went on for a long time.

Sri Hari listened the prayer of Kaarpara Rishi appeared before him with Sri Narasimha Roopa. And said that He is satisfied with his prayer and Tapasya.Told Rishi to ask any Boon(VARA).Kaarpara  answered that he does want anything except the blessings,pooja and
Prayer of Sri Hari and requested the Lord to reside there permanently.Sri Hari agreed said TATHAASTU.Soon the God disappeared leaving two Saaligramas under that Ashwath Vraksha.Kaarpara Rishi worshipped Narasimha Saaligrama from that dayonwards regularly.That place
is called and named as Kaarpara-then it became Koppara-Koppara NarasimhaDevaru due to  our Kaarpara Rishi.Today  KOPPARA  is a Punyakshetra.

Koppara NarasimhaDevaru is the Kulaswami of several families today.In the Ashwath Vraksha Swami Narasimha Devaru became Pratyaksha-that Tree is called as God's Tree.Daily Pooja-Naivedya-Alankara.Strict Purity,Sanctity are all maintained in Koppara in the Sannidhana of Narasimha Devaru(Sri Hari).

Koppara is situated in Devadurga Taluka,Raichur District, Karnataka State(India),on the bank of Krishna river with profound silence,calm and
loneliness welcoming the Devotees and Satvikas to Bless.
